请描述您的问题地址:https://cloud.tencent.com/act/bargin?utm_source=portal&utm_medium=banner&utm_campaign=bargin&utm_term=1204Mozilla/5.0 (Macintosh; Intel Mac OS X 10_12_6)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/63.0.3239.84 Safari/537.36
首先,我熟悉微服务是什么,它们是如何相互通信的,一般流程等等。现在,我已经习惯于为我的后端( API )使用标准的3层应用程序,并且想知道1微服务的体系结构是什么,因为我真的找不到关于它的东西,或者甚至有一种通用的方法来清除1项服务。我总是很想用同样的方式编写我的微服务,一个微服务有一个API作为入口点,一个BL代表逻辑,一个DAL用于DB操作,但是我有一种奇怪的感觉,那就是构建一个“微点monolith”。因此,我的问题是:是否有一个通用的方法来设计一个MS,还是3层